It’s Not Just One Show

Summer Game Fest isn’t a single event.
It’s a loose cluster of shows that all happen around the same time.

I watch the main Geoff Keighley show. Sure. But I also clear my calendar for Xbox Games Showcase.

And the PC Gaming Show. And Ubisoft Forward. And PlayStation State of Play.

And Devolver Digital’s weird, brilliant spectacle.

These aren’t side acts. They’re core parts of the festival. They just run on their own schedules.

Sometimes hours apart, sometimes days apart.

You’re probably wondering: When is the Summer Game Fest 2024 Altwaygamers?
The answer isn’t one date. It’s a window. Usually late May through mid-June.

Each partner announces its own time and stream link separately.

That means trailers drop across multiple days. Not just one big dump. More breathing room.

Less panic-scrolling. (Though let’s be real (you’ll) still refresh Twitter every five minutes.)

Some shows go live on YouTube. Others use Twitch. A few even drop surprise clips on TikTok.

No central calendar exists. You have to follow each studio or outlet individually.
